The Transformation Begins

Released on June 26, 2020, BLACKPINK's "How You Like That" served as a bold statement of intent. The song, produced by Teddy Park and co-written by members of the group, not only marked their return after a lengthy hiatus but also signaled a significant evolution in their artistic identity. This track encapsulated a newfound confidence, presenting a blend of hip-hop, EDM, and pop that pushed the boundaries of K-pop.

Global Impact and Chart Success

Upon its release, "How You Like That" broke multiple records, including the most-viewed YouTube video in 24 hours, showcasing BLACKPINK's unparalleled reach. This achievement is a testament to their ability to connect with fans across cultures and languages, reinforcing their status as K-pop's leading girl group. Their sound, once distinctly tied to the genre's conventions, has now transcended those boundaries.
